How they compare

Malaysia currently reports 3.22 million kg against 2.04 million kg in Bhutan, a difference of 1.18 million kg.

That makes Malaysia's figure about 1.6 times Bhutan's.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Malaysia has been ahead every year.

Bhutan ranks 27th and Malaysia ranks 26th of 69 countries.

Malaysia has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bhutan Malaysia Difference Ahead
1960s 113,896 kg 15.08 million kg 14.97 million kg Malaysia
1970s 142,303 kg 12.89 million kg 12.74 million kg Malaysia
1980s 180,674 kg 10.55 million kg 10.36 million kg Malaysia
1990s 76,964 kg 6.85 million kg 6.77 million kg Malaysia
2000s 911,199 kg 5.94 million kg 5.03 million kg Malaysia
2010s 1.67 million kg 5.27 million kg 3.61 million kg Malaysia
2020s 1.88 million kg 3.04 million kg 1.16 million kg Malaysia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
